The adventure starts with dinner.
Saddle Road
Next, you’ll travel across Saddle Road between Mauna Kea and Mauna Loa, two of the tallest and most massive volcanoes on Earth. Your National Park Service trained guide will discuss the volcanology, geology, and history of these monstrous wonders, as well as providing in-depth narration on the various lava flows and flora and fauna that you’ll be passing by. Lastly, your guide will take you to one of our preferred locations on Mauna Kea for nighttime stargazing.

The tour was a great experience. Nice dinner and good hot choc at the end. Marcus drove the Saddle Road, set us up for sunset viewing near a parking lot and if there were no partial clouds obscuring would have set up the solarscope, and then drove to a secluded spot for 1.30-2 hours using his portable Dobsonian telescope giving each of us turns to watch e.g. Alpha Centauri (a twin star!), Venus and as top of the bill Saturn with the clearly visible ring pattern. And in between used the laser pointer to show lots of stars and nebulas. Even had 3 falling stars, a rarity! However we were disappointed that all only went to 6000 feet (2 km), meaning we missed the far better sunset views including ocean from the visitors centre. (Summit is not really needed to visit, partly due to sensitivity for local culture but also as it’s simply too cold and can bring altitude sickness). Company delivers as advertised, but we should have read better – though the pickup options in Kona for this tour were amongst the best. The tour would, both because of less delivered quality and of far less fuel cost for the company compared to the other routes, need to be sold at USD 75 at least below the current level. For the current level of price, go for a tour that visits the visitor centre (9000 ft/3km) for sunset vistas (and stargazing similar to this one) like Mauna Kea Summit sunset and stars, Mauna Kea Summit tour, Mauna Kea stargazing experience.
